Southmeadow Pizza in Plymouth
202 S Meadow Rd, 02330 - Get directionsMenu Southmeadow Pizza
How to get to Southmeadow Pizza
Opening Time
Sunday - 11AM-9PMMonday - 11AM-9PM
Tuesday - 11AM-9PM
Wednesday - 11AM-9PM
Thursday - 11AM-9PM
Friday - 11AM-9PM
Saturday - 11AM-9PM
Services
- Wheelchair accessible
- Delivery
- Takeaway
- Booking
Related to Southmeadow Pizza
8.1
Based on 3 reviews
Yelp
8.0
8.2
Butch Derochea
Great food you must go soon
Stephanie Miller
Very good pizza!
Deanna Wood
Great sub's and pizza. Friendly service.